2. Freelance WordPress Designer vs. Freelance WordPress Developer
This is the Coffee vs. Espresso debate of the tech world. While they share the same roots, their experiences differ.
| Feature | Freelance WordPress Designer | Freelance WordPress Developer |
| Primary Goal | User Experience (UX) & Visual Identity | Functional Logic & Backend Stability |
| Tools of Trade | Figma, Adobe XD, CSS3, Page Builders | PHP, SQL, JavaScript, REST APIs |
| Output | High-conversion layouts & Branding | Custom plugins & Database management |

6. SEO-First WordPress Design Approach
If a tree falls in a forest, does it make a noise if there’s no one around to hear it? A nice website that is on page 10 of Google will not help you sell. No way!
We create our sites to have SEO built into them. Here is how we do this:
- Semantic HTML: We use specific HTML tags to assist Google in understanding what the content is about.
- Schema Markup: We let search engines know exactly what a product costs, its rating and where the product is located.
- Image Alt-Text: We make sure that every image on your site looks attractive, but also helps with rankings.
7. Improving Performance: The Silent Salesman
According to the statistics, a single second difference in load time can cause conversion rates to drop by 7%. Optimizing performance isn’t just about adding a caching plugin to your site and calling it good!
We will evaluate:
- Optimizing at the server level: Selecting the best possible host (not necessarily the cheapest).
- Minifying your code: Deleting the unnecessary parts of your scripts.
- Integrating a CDN: Ensuring fast load times in locations around the world (e.g., loading quickly in London, NY, and Sydney).

9. Rates for Freelance WordPress Designers – How Much is Your Time Worth?
Price is what you pay; Value is what you receive.
- Entry Level: $15 – $30 per hour – Entry-level freelance designers are best suited for smaller blogs.
- Mid-Level: $50 – $80 per hour – Most small and medium-sized businesses (SMEs) will find that the mid-range pricing of a freelance designer is the perfect fit for their needs.
- Expert Level: $100 – $250 per hour – Solving complex business problems through consulting services.

Q: Why WordPress? Why not Shopify?
A: Shopify is great for pure retail, but WordPress offers unparalleled SEO and customization freedom. It’s the difference between renting an apartment (Shopify) and owning the land (WordPress).
